Assured of a new respite of one month, Iran continues to enrich uranium



The Gauntlet has lasted seven and a half years since that beautiful day in August 2002, a clandestine nuclear program in Iran was fanned by the opposition in exile, Tehran has been stopped defending its prerogatives in the civil nuclear discourage inspectors of the International Atomic Energy Agency (IAEA) in their investigation into the true nature of this program ... and systematically breaking its word.

Iranian diplomacy, has mastered the art of rolling its Western counterparts in flour, just won yet another triumph. On 17 May, the Shiite regime has gained a new respite, through Brazil and Turkey, accepting an exchange of nuclear fuel in Turkish territory, on its own terms.

non-permanent members to the Security Council, Turks and Brazilians have managed to temporarily paralyze Western attempts to impose a fourth element of international sanctions against Iran, after those already enacted since March 2006. These new sanctions, scheduled for mid-June, are postponed indefinitely, other "non-permanent "Supporting the Brazilian President Luis Inacio Lula da Silva believes he can force his" friend "Mahmoud Ahmadinejad, the Iranian head of state to make concessions. Regardless of whether they have violated the rules of the IAEA, which is headquartered in Vienna, which monitors and fiercely on the dividing line increasingly blurring between civil and military nuclear.

Within a month, therefore, Iran must be filed in Turkey 1200 kg of low enriched uranium (LEU) to 3.5%. If this condition is fulfilled, he will get in the twelve months 120 kg of HEU enriched uranium (HEU) to 19.75% in the form of fuel rods formatted for civilian use only. They feed into the research reactor in Tehran (TRR), the production of isotopes used for medical purposes but whose reserves were beginning to drop dangerously.

The problem is that Iran really is continuing to flout its international commitments on nuclear safeguards, while violating the Security Council resolutions requiring him four years to stop its enrichment activities to uranium. Budapest wants granting Hungarian citizenship to 3.5 million Hungarian-speaking


Viktor Orban, the new Hungarian Prime Minister, vowed to make the absolute priority of his mandate. Before you even think about lowering taxes, boost growth, cut public spending, however, essential steps to stem the recession more dramatic in Central Europe, he was granted Hungarian citizenship to 3.5 million Hungarian-speaking living outside its borders. For those ethnic Hungarians who live mainly in neighboring countries (Slovakia, Romania, Austria, Croatia, Slovenia and Ukraine), the painful " injustice of Trianon", named after the peace treaty in 1920 eponymous amputated the "great Hungary " two-thirds of its territory, had to be repaired.

Just installed on the throne, the leader of Fidesz (conservative) has delivered. With a two-thirds parliamentary majority, the largest ever made to support a democratic government in Europe since the end of World War II, Orban submitted Monday to the House a bill to that effect. It could be adopted on August 20, National Day of Hungary, and enter into force on 1 st January 2011, the day when Hungary will assume the presidency of the European Union for six months. Citing the U.S. example where 117,000 Hungarians settled in the U.S. have dual citizenship, the foreign minister Janos Martonyi said that it would be granted " on an individual basis" to those who would " d ancestry Magyar and Hungarian-speaking .

old sea serpent of Hungarian politics, the question of the nationality of the Hungarian minorities led to the holding of a referendum in 2004, already initiated by the then opposition Fidesz. There it was damned close to that Hungary does not cause a serious crisis with its neighbors in Central Europe. Less than 40% of voters had moved, indicating a relative lack of interest in the subject, and canceled the election.

Much has changed in six years, Hungary has experienced the worst riots in recent history in the fall of 2006, because of the lies of Socialist Prime Minister at the time, Ferenc Gyurcsany, the real state of the economy. Since then, nationalist sentiment flourished in the country, coupled with a widening gulf between the elites and the people. In the far right has created a movement paramilitary, the "Hungarian Guard", disbanded July 2, 2009 by justice but whose members continue to parade carrying the flag striped red and white symbol of the millennium Hungary Arpad, the Magyar Clovis, but also the ex-Nazi party of the "Arrow Cross". Hungarian Prime Minister he signed a compromise with the Jobbik discreet, far-right party halo of 16% of the vote in parliamentary elections on April 25? "Orban wanted to give pledges nationalists, said Anton Pelinka, a political scientist at Central European University (CEU) in Budapest. As he did not want to encourage anti-Semitism, or xenophobia, especially against Roma (Gypsies), he played a card more "moderate", that of dual citizenship for Hungarian-speaking minorities abroad .

The danger could come from the interminable quarrel with Slovakia, rather finicky about the status of its Hungarian minority, with about 500 000 people, representing 10% of the total population, which it refuses the exception language. "The initiative Orban is a serious provocation in the eyes of Slovaks , may also Romanians, continues Pelinka. She'll wake nationalism antagonists within the European Union .

If the bill did not make waves in Vojvodina Serbian and Romanian Transylvania, home to large communities in Hungary, Slovakia has already warned that it would protest to the Organization for Security and Cooperation in Europe (OSCE), whose headquarters are in Vienna. Robert Fico, Slovakian Prime Minister, has called a "security threat " projects Fidesz and recalled the Slovak ambassador stationed in Hungary for consultations. Between Bratislava and Budapest, the cloth burning again.
